    The reasoning for the change has to do with players like me. Specifically, heroic adventures scale with level. If left alone, Scouting Ahead would have been not only the best way to grind for this expansion, but for level 110, 120, hell even 200. No matter how compelling they attempt to make experience in the new expansion, there is simply no way to compete with trash that can be pulled in double digit amounts and beamed down. I abused this heavily, and as a result leveling to 105 took a matter of hours. It was a problem - even if it was hilariously fun. Like it or not, there are a ton of players who will resort to instant gratification at some point. I *could* have done it in thirty hours. I chose the more efficient route. It isn't as boring as you may think when you're blasting through Gribble at close to the 5 minute lockout and hearing that so, so sweet sound for AA's going off like a machine gun.

    From my perspective, there were three options that could have made sense:

    1. Reduce xp per mob (chosen)
    2. Apply the lockout upon entry, similar to how the one-off raids work
    3. Stop CoTF Heroics from scaling beyond 100.

    None of these options would have been popular. They probably chose the best one - I can only imagine the fury of the forums on some of the others. My question isn't why - I know why. My question is 'why now?' This problem has been in existence, and they've known its been in existence, for a long time. We've had free reign on this for a full year now. I find it hard to believe they didn't see this coming. If they didn't, they're way more out of touch with the player base than I ever imagined. I still ponder why they did this with the release of TDS, associating the new expansion with nerfs that should have been resolved with a better solution long before we ever got so accustomed to the broken status quo.     The best solution was to make 1 regular hitting/hp/exp mob pop from each flower, lower the ZEM in the gribble mission, and make a few minor adjustments on exp gains for any other missions of interest.

    The reality is, if something else doesn't scale well in the future in these HAs, you can still just chain a few different ones to get massive exp (people still getting 11% of a level on the gribble mission that some people can finish in 10 minutes, how is that addressed if you can find X other missions to do the same thing?).

    This just punishes the wrong people.

    Scaling infinitely was a dumb idea anyway. They aren't putting new gear for higher levels on older expansion HAs, so zero reason to not just have them max out at 100 for anyone above 100 and let normal eq inflation happen.

    Blanket changes to address specific idiosyncratic issues is always a lazy poor design choice, particularly when its rushed out with little testing. Find the problem, fix the problem, don't neuter entire reams of content, abilities, playstyles, whatever, because some people can smash specific content set ups faster than you anticipated.
